William Barnes (died 1558)
William Barnes, Barne, Barneis or Berners (by 1502-58), of Thoby, Essex, was an English politician.
Family
Barnes had four sons, including the MP for Wigan, William Barnes, and one daughter.
Career
He was a Member (MP) of the Parliament of England for Marlborough 1542, Taunton April 1554, Downton November 1554 and East Grinstead 1555.[1]
